EPISODE CONTEXT

Sitting at episode 8 of 13, this lands right past the season's midpoint and pivots from the world-building and environmental horror of Episode 7's 'Flowers and Offerings' toward deeper character excavation. By investing in the Tenza-Shion relationship now, the series raises personal stakes heading into the back half. It directly sets the table for Episode 9, 'Gods and People,' where the narrative's mythological and human threads are poised to collide with greater intensity.
